From 2ece96546ec80bf26013d005967cbfdc06156ee7 Mon Sep 17 00:00:00 2001 From: mrDarker <mr.darker@163.com> Date: 星期二, 17 六月 2025 16:32:41 +0800 Subject: [PATCH] 1. 添加配方管理类(数据库) 2. 修改用户管理和系统日志管理类的路径和名称 3. 修复合并代码导致系统日志管理窗口的资源异常的问题 --- SourceCode/Bond/BondEq/CPageAlarm.h | 30 ++++++++++++++++++++++++++++++ 1 files changed, 30 insertions(+), 0 deletions(-) diff --git a/SourceCode/Bond/BondEq/CPageAlarm.h b/SourceCode/Bond/BondEq/CPageAlarm.h index 2fdbcb7..7d88e52 100644 --- a/SourceCode/Bond/BondEq/CPageAlarm.h +++ b/SourceCode/Bond/BondEq/CPageAlarm.h @@ -1,4 +1,5 @@ #pragma once +#include "AlarmMonitor.h" // CPageAlarm 对话框 @@ -13,11 +14,34 @@ private: void InitRxWindow(); + void Resize(); + void LoadAlarms(); + void AddAlarm(CAlarmMonitor* pMonitor, CAlarm* pAlarm); + void UpdateAlarm(CAlarmMonitor* pMonitor, CAlarm* pAlarm); + void UpdatePageData(); + void UpdatePageControls(); + void FillDataToListCtrl(CListCtrl* pListCtrl, const std::vector<std::vector<std::string>>& vecData); private: COLORREF m_crBkgnd; HBRUSH m_hbrBkgnd; IObserver* m_pObserver; + + // 关键字 + std::string m_strKeyword; + + // 页码 + int m_nCurPage; + int m_nTotalPages; + + // 日期 + int m_nDateTimeFlag; + char m_szTimeStart[64]; + char m_szTimeEnd[64]; + + // 控件 + CDateTimeCtrl m_dateTimeStart; + CDateTimeCtrl m_dateTimeEnd; // 对话框数据 @@ -34,4 +58,10 @@ afx_msg HBRUSH OnCtlColor(CDC* pDC, CWnd* pWnd, UINT nCtlColor); afx_msg void OnDestroy(); afx_msg void OnSize(UINT nType, int cx, int cy); + virtual BOOL DestroyWindow(); + afx_msg void OnCbnSelchangeComboDatetime(); + afx_msg void OnBnClickedButtonSearch(); + afx_msg void OnBnClickedButtonExport(); + afx_msg void OnBnClickedButtonPrevPage(); + afx_msg void OnBnClickedButtonNextPage(); }; -- Gitblit v1.9.3